Are you using a non-English or unusual character? (e.g. a character with an accent mark, umlaut, etc?) I had a similar issue when trying to check in a contributor change by someone named André, and changing the é to an e allowed me to check it in.

I'm thinking maybe it's the subviews.| part. Try getting rid of the vertical line.
